What is a Data Analyst?

A data analyst gathers, processes, and examines datasets using different methods and specialized software. They unveil trends, connections, and useful insights to help organizations in the decision-making process. Data analysts work with sectors like finance, marketing, healthcare, and technology to assist organizations in enhancing efficiency, boosting outcomes, and reaching objectives through data-driven decisions.

What Is Data Analysis and Why Does it Matter?

Data analysis is the process of refining, transforming, and shaping data to derive insights and assist in decision-making.

1. Data Analysis Process

1.1. Reviewing and Refining

Data analysis involves examining data to spot loopholes, errors, or missing values and fixing them to ensure data precision and reliability.

1.2. Identifying Patterns and Trends

Using techniques such as machine learning, and data analysis helps uncover hidden patterns, trends, relationships, and insights within datasets. 

1.3. Decision-Making Support

Data analysis allows organizations to make informed decisions, simplify operations, and guide future business strategies.

Key Skills for Data Analysts

Data Analyst Skills

1. Database Tools

While Excel can be found in many industries, SQL is indispensable for managing and analyzing complex datasets, therefore it should be noted that analysts ought to know how to operate these two database tools because they are highly flexible concerning dataset size.

2. Programming Languages

If you want to handle datasets and perform complex analyses then proficiency in programming languages such as Python or R would be more useful. Nevertheless, requirements may differ depending on the job and it can sometimes be helpful to look at job postings to know which language best suits your field of specialization.

3. Data visualization

For data analysts, making sure that insights are excellently communicated through support is very important. Common tools used include Tableau, Jupyter Notebook, and Excel to make beautiful charts and graphs which help in passing on findings to investors.

4. Statistics and Mathematics

Decisions in data analytics require a thorough understanding of principles as well as mathematical concepts. This knowledge of statistics helps in selecting the tools for identifying differences in data and making valid interpretations.

Tools for Data Analysis

Data analysts often use various tools to make their work more accurate and efficient during data analysis. Here are some set of tools that are used in Data Analysis.

1. Basic Tools

1.1. Microsoft Excel

Excel is a spreadsheet software for working with data that is well known in use and has an easy-to-use interface covering simple to advanced tasks to be done on data.

1.2. SQL

Structured Query Language (SQL) allows users to manage relational databases by providing a way of querying, inserting, updating, and deleting rows, including defining tables or manipulating other database structures.

2. Advanced Tools

2.1. Python

Python is an all-purpose language known for its ease of learning and clear syntax. It has rich libraries dedicated to data analysis, machine learning, web development, etc.

2.2. R Programming Language

R is an open-source programming language and software environment intended chiefly for statistical computing and graphics. It is a preferred tool among statisticians and data scientists due to its strength in analyzing complex data sets.

    2.3. Tableau

    Tableau is a graphical representation program used in the preparation of interactive and sharable dashboards, charts, or reports from different sources of information without needing extensive coding skills.

    2.4. Power BI

    Power BI is Microsoft Business Analytics tool offering interactive visualization features around self-service business intelligence capabilities alongside data preparation options.

    2.5. MATLAB

    MATLAB is a programming language and computing environment mainly used for numerical computation, data analysis, algorithm development, and visualization, particularly in engineering and scientific research.

    2.6. SAS

    The SAS is a software suite used in advanced analytics, business intelligence, and data management, providing various statistical analysis and predictive modeling capabilities.

    2.7. Apache Spark

    Apache Spark is a distributed computing system designed to run big data quickly and generally by supporting Spark APIs in Java, Scala, Python, or R.

    3. Emerging Tools

    3.1. Google Looker

    Google Looker is a modern business intelligence (BI) and data analytics platform that helps organizations explore, analyze, and share data insights. It provides powerful tools for data exploration and visualization, focusing on providing data-driven decision-making at scale. Looker is often used by data analysts, engineers, and business users for deep data analysis and reporting.

    3.2. Google Data Studio

    Google Data Studio is a free business intelligence and data visualization tool developed by Google. It allows users to create interactive and shareable reports and dashboards. With Google Data Studio, you can integrate data from various sources, including Google Analytics, Google Ads, Google Sheets, and third-party services through connectors.

    Types of Data Analysts

    Data analysts play an important role in fields like law enforcement, fashion, culinary arts, technology, business, environmental studies, and public administration.

    They are also known by job titles, like:

    1. Research Analysts

    Research Analyst collects, analyze, and interpret data to support decision-making in various industries, often focusing on academic or scientific research, market trends, and industry patterns.

    2. Business Analysts

    Business Analyst assess business processes, identify issues, and provide data-driven recommendations to improve efficiency, profitability, and overall business performance.

    3. Medical and Healthcare Analysts

    These analysts use data to improve patient care, streamline operations, and optimize healthcare policies by analyzing health data, trends, and outcomes related to Medical and Healthcare Field.

    4. Business Intelligence Analysts

    Business Intelligence Analyst focuses on gathering, analyzing, and presenting data to inform strategic business decisions, utilizing tools like dashboards and data visualization to track key metrics.

    5. Market Research Analysts

    They examine market conditions and consumer behavior by analyzing data, trends, and competitors to help businesses develop effective marketing strategies.

    6. Operations Research Analysts

    They apply mathematical and analytical methods to solve complex operational problems, optimizing resources, logistics, and systems within organizations.
